Lawsuit: Bed Bath & Beyond Sold Falsely Labeled 'Egyptian Cotton' Sheets

by Corrado Rizzi

Last Updated on May 8, 2018

Blair et al v. Bed Bath & Beyond, Inc.

Filed: January 24, 2017 § 0:17-cv-60178-DMM

Bed Bath & Beyond, Inc. for years marketed and sold to consumers bed sheets that were falsely labeled as '100 % Egyptian Cotton,' a new proposed class action lawsuit.
